Transaction 9868cf30acc894eb53c1b3013fd40173d924ab84acc9540210badbccaff829e2
1 Input
1 Output
-
9868cf30acc894eb53c1b3013fd40173d924ab84acc9540210badbccaff829e2:0
- value
- 19311599
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 70efd5a9fc94b403583bde00343c8eb67cff3cd0 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1BJ9zVEuwJLT759wrrebA4Lb1DEJV3gA66